Output d38e63faf28fe048e7835244b9ea0a3ebdd8452d7d7fbe2f670aa98c1ae3fdae:3

value
1781585
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4ff8416e830f4399ac47c637edfdb0a82e19f3b4 OP_EQUAL
address
38yrhoKB9UL4VAAbACmFEmpjPcwdwL6oDy
transaction
d38e63faf28fe048e7835244b9ea0a3ebdd8452d7d7fbe2f670aa98c1ae3fdae
spent
true